One of my oldest memories involves you. It was 1981, I was four years old and my cousin was sixteen. She had The Wall on vinyl. We were at our grandparents house and she was angry because our grandfather wouldn’t let her go out with her friends. She brought me into the bedroom where the record player was and locked the door. The Wall album started playing and the volume was maxed out. Our grandfather was livid when we came out of the room. I had on tons of makeup, my hair was teased and stiffened with Aqua Net hairspray, my fingernails were painted blue, and I was a brand new Floydian. Since that day, you have remained my favorite. In my highest of highs and my lowest of lows, you were there. You are unlike anyone or anything else. Pink Floyd, your words and sound are purely magical and I will always love you the most.
